1-Acetyl-2-azetidinecarboxylic acid

Description:
1-Acetyl-2-azetidinecarboxylic acid is a chemical compound characterized by its unique structure, which includes an azetidine ring—a four-membered nitrogen-containing heterocycle. This compound features an acetyl group and a carboxylic acid functional group, contributing to its reactivity and potential applications in organic synthesis and medicinal chemistry. The presence of the azetidine ring may impart specific steric and electronic properties, influencing its behavior in chemical reactions. Typically, compounds like this can exhibit both acidic and basic characteristics due to the carboxylic acid and the nitrogen atom in the azetidine ring, respectively. The compound's molecular structure allows for various interactions, making it a candidate for further research in drug development or as a building block in synthetic chemistry. Its CAS number, 474013-98-4, serves as a unique identifier for regulatory and safety information. As with many organic compounds, the stability, solubility, and reactivity can vary based on environmental conditions and the presence of other functional groups.
Formula:C6H9NO3
Synonyms:
  • 2-Azetidinecarboxylic acid, 1-acetyl-
